Getting There

Fly into Cancún International Airport, located about two hours away by car. Opt for a private transfer or a reputable car rental service for a comfortable and scenic drive to Tulum.

Tips for the Destination

  • Currency: While some places accept USD, it's best to have Mexican Pesos for local transactions.

  • Language: Spanish is the primary language, but English is widely spoken in tourist areas.

  • Safety: Tulum is generally safe, but exercise usual precautions and stay in well-lit areas at night.

Where to Stay

Be Tulum Hotel offers luxury with its beachfront location, private pools, and exceptional service. For a jungle retreat, consider staying at Azulik, an eco-friendly resort that blends luxury with nature.

What to Pack

  • Sun Protection: High-SPF s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ses.

  • Beachwear: Swimsuits, cover-ups, and flip-flops.

  • Evening Attire: Tulum's nightlife is vibrant yet casual; pack light, elegant clothing.

  • Eco-Friendly Items: Reusable water bottle and biodegradable sunscreen to protect the environment.

Itinerary

Day 1: Arrival and Relaxation

- Check into your resort and unwind with a beachside welcome drink.

- Enjoy a leisurely lunch and afternoon spa treatment.

- Dinner at a beach club, blending gourmet dining with the sounds of the ocean.

Day 2: Cultural Exploration

- Morning tour of the Tulum Ruins.

- Afternoon excursion to Sian Ka'an Biosphere Reserve.

- Dine at ARCA, surrounded by the jungle's ambiance.

Day 3: Adventure and Leisure

- Morning adventure to Cenote Dos Ojos for snorkeling.

- Relax at the resort or explore local shops and galleries.

- Private beach dinner curated by your resort's chef.

Getting Around

Renting a bike or scooter is a popular and eco-friendly way to explore Tulum's beaches and town. For longer distances or more comfort, private taxis or car rentals are readily available.
